History

The PNR was established in February 2000, has its origins among the supporters of the various small parties, movements and coalitions of the nationalist right (Party of Christian Democracy, Independent Movement for National Reconstruction/Party of the Portuguese Right, National Front), which emerged following the PREC, all extinct after some time electoral activity without appreciable results.

After the failure of the experiences of the PDC, MIRN/PDP and FN, and overcome the difficulties encountered by militants of the nationalist right in order to bring the five thousand signatures needed to form a party, acquisition of a centre/liberal center-left party in the bankruptcy (the PRD) presented as an opportunity.

The PRD had fallen into decay, had accumulated debts and had no activity but was not extinguished. It was then that elements of the National Alliance and the defunct National Action Movement (MAN) have joined the PRD, have paid their debts, and, once in control of the party changed its name to National Renewal Party (PNR) with a new program.
